Reliable Sourcing of Industrial Chemicals: Suppliers & Distributors Compared
Securing a consistent provision of high-quality industrial chemicals is vital for any manufacturing operation. Many businesses face the challenge of whether to acquire directly from vendors or utilize a reseller. Vendors often offer competitive pricing and potential for customized formulations, but may involve larger minimums and increased administrative workload. Conversely, Distributors generally provide a wider selection of products, faster turnaround, and reduced liability regarding inventory management, although potentially at a slightly higher fee. Careful evaluation of these factors – including certifications, regulatory conformance, geographical reach and reputation – is paramount when selecting the right source for your industrial chemical needs.
